As the poll says... Both were sporting saloons aiming at the top end of the market, both had similar power and engine sizes, both were advanced for the time (16v head and fuel injection), but which would you prefer now? I really can't decide... I love 2002s but I've always fancied a really clean Dolly Sprint too... Pics to support your choice would be welcome ;D

I drove both for Classics (plus an Avenger Tiger). On the day I chose the Dolly. But I went out and bought an 02... Why? The 02 is just a better car for everyday use and IMHO, looks cooler. AND you don't have to deal with Rimmer Brothers and their joke-shop prices. Although Jaymic can be a bit of a laff with their prices (take the price from your local BMW dealer and add 5% generally). They're both cool cars, though.
